The Sony Xperia E C1604 is a sleek, unlocked Android phone featuring a 3.5-inch TFT display, a powerful 1 GHz Qualcomm processor, and a 3.2 MP camera. With dual-SIM capabilities and impressive battery life, it’s designed for the modern professional who values both functionality and style.

Great for a phone. If you want a smart phone...try something else.
If all you really want to do is talk/text and surf the internet occasionally, then this phone's perfect. Not to mention, it's dual SIM and the color is as nice as the price.Pros:* Nice color. Amazon doesn't show the color in it's best light. It really is a rose/bronze with silver undertones? I don't know how to explain it, but champagne is definitely the color to explain it. I just think that pics don't show it right.* Dual sim card* Very simple interface. Pull down menu allows you to quickly switch between cards, turn off/on SIM data traffic (i.e. internet via phone carrier), turn off/on WiFi, turn off/on bluetooth* Sound: Aside from normal volume control, there is a a menu item for X-loud which uses the internal speaker of the phone to make sounds louder. Let me tell you...with it off, the loudest setting is not that loud. But with it on...IT IS LOUD!!!!* Nice design. Feels good in the hand and not heavy. Does not need a cover. The screen is very resistant to fingerprints and scratches. I have a screen protector even though, and it is scratched already as well as a fingerprint magnet. That is within days, when I had the phone for a good month before putting on a screen protector and I never had any issues.* Internet while on my home WiFi network is great. (I usually only turn it on for a quick check on the internet or I keep it on so I can chat via an app I have downloaded)* Google Play store (already loaded is other Google apps as well Facebook extensions etc... I don't use these though)* Has a slot in back to hang a phone charm* Sound quality is really really good. What do you expect from Sony? (and I'm not talking about just phone calls, I mean any songs you load onto the phone)Cons:* It is a bit light weight. If you want something bulkier, this is not for you. The battery cover feels sturdy on, but off is a bit flimsy.* Graphics: You can tell the quality is not HD. It's more noticeable if you take a picture or if you are watching YouTube or some video. That's when you can really tell.* Keyboard: If you have chubby fingers or like typing vertically (like I do), you will OFTEN hit the wrong keys. If you aren't much of a texter, this won't matter.* The clock is a bit annoying. If I leave the clock on as my default while I'm not using it, when I go to use my phone, it will be the same time that it was when I left it. Only after "waking it up" will it change the time and I find that really annoying. Note that this is ONLY for the clock widget. The actual time that you see on your phone in the top corner is always running accordingly and correct.* Pics are ok. Like I said, this is not the best in graphics or resolution. There is only a back camera, but it has basic features and you can take a quick pic if you need.* Worst thing about the phone that I don't like: In bright light (i.e. out in Sunny California) you will have major issues seeing the screen. It is all dark and very very difficult to see. You will have to seek shade or wait until you are indoors to see it properly.* Dual SIM is Dual SIM standby. You can only use one SIM at a time. I don't have a problem with this, but if you are meaning to have 2 numbers running at the same time on a phone, this is NOT for you.* SD card can take up to 32 GB. This is mentioned in the cons as well because a lot of apps require to be put on the phone and will not save to the SD card. The internal memory is only about 2 GB I think. So, if you are an app person, this is also not for you. I only have a few apps (MagicJack, a gchat one and then whatever was pre-installed) so I don't have any issues.I think I might have forgotten some points, but overall I really like the phone. I bought it from Amazon when it went to $120 something. I use it for phone/text and occasional internet. No issues so far regarding those aspects. I do wish resolution was better and the camera as well...but for what's it's worth, it's good for a basic phone with internet capabilities.

Hard To Change Default SIM
I use both SIMs - one for professional and one for friends. It's clumsy to inform the phone which SIM one wishes to call or send from. One has to go deep into "settings" to switch the "default" SIM. Further, incoming text messages to one SIM (phone number) get blended with the messages incoming to the other SIM (phone number). Voice mail is the worst. After one listens to voice mail from one SIM, the "message waiting" icon goes off, and one has to go change the default SIM, then check voice mail for the other SIM because there may be unheard messages there.Later: I have to be honest. I found a better way to switch the "default" SIM - Slide the main screen to the left and change it there. No solution for the voice mail or message problem though. This phone was put on the market in 2013, and once the alarm goes off - it cannot be silenced if one has it in one's pocket and touches the screen getting it out unless one totally shuts the phone off (holding on-off button for 6 seconds). One would think they would have fixed that by this time.
